Frequently Asked Questions
- What weight shock oil do I need for my RC vehicle? — The correct weight depends on your vehicle type, track conditions, and driving style. The 50 weight (600 cSt) formulation offered here is a versatile middle option suitable for most RC cars, trucks, and buggies. Lighter weights (20-30 wt) are better for soft tracks or smooth surfaces, while heavier weights (60-80 wt) suit rough terrain, high-speed driving, and rock crawling. Consult your vehicle's manual or contact experienced RC retailers for specific recommendations for your model.

- How often should I change my shock oil? — Shock oil should be serviced regularly depending on how frequently you drive and the conditions you use your RC vehicle in. After 10-15 hours of driving or if you notice diminished suspension performance, it's time to service your shocks by draining and replacing the oil with fresh Traxxas shock oil.
- Can I mix different brands of shock oil? — It's best practice to use the same brand and formulation throughout your shocks for consistency. Mixing brands or weights may result in unpredictable suspension behaviour, so when servicing, drain old oil completely and refill with fresh Traxxas oil of the same weight.
